Common reasons safes stay shut
It's not always a forgotten code. Sometimes the electric batteries in the electronic lock have leaked, or the solenoid—the small part that really pulls the bolt back—has given up the ghost. On mechanised safes, the internal tires can drift out of alignment more than decades of make use of. Sometimes, believe it or not, the safe is simply too full. If you've stuffed too many papers in generally there, they could press against the locking mounting bolts, creating enough friction that the electric motor or the dial just can't shift them.
Precisely why You Shouldn't Try out to Be the Hero
We've all seen the particular movies where the guy puts a stethoscope to the door, turns the call, and click , it opens. In reality, it doesn't function like that. If a person try to DO-IT-YOURSELF your way into a high-security safe and sound, you're likely to trigger what's known as a "relocker. "
The relocker is really a secondary security measure designed to permanently lock the safe if it detects someone is trying to force it open or drill down it improperly. Once those fire, even a professional פורץ כספות is going to possess a very much harder (and even more expensive) time obtaining in. It's just like a medical surgery; in case you try to do it yourself using a kitchen knife, the particular surgeon's job will become ten times tougher later on.
Avoid the particular YouTube tutorials that tell you shed the safe from the certain height or even use an enormous magnet. Most contemporary safes are made in order to withstand those specific tricks, and you'll likely just end up getting a broken safe and sound and a very sore back.
What a Professional פורץ כספות Actually Does
When the particular pro arrives, they aren't likely to simply start swinging a hammer. A true פורץ כספות is part engineer and part detective. They'll first attempt to diagnose exactly why the particular safe isn't opening. Is it the mechanical failure? The lockout? A dead keypad?
The art of manipulation
If a person have an old-school dial safe plus it's a mechanised issue, some professionals can still "manipulate" the lock. This involves feeling the vibration and listening in order to the sounds associated with the wheels as they drop directly into place. It's the dying art form, honestly. It requires a huge amount of patience and a very gentle touch. The best part relating to this technique? The safe continues to be completely undamaged. You can keep using it the second they're done.
Going (The surgical way)
Sometimes, going could be the only method in. But this isn't "drilling the hole" like you're hanging an image framework. A פורץ כספות uses specialized rigs and diamond-tipped bits going to a very specific point—sometimes only a few millimeters wide—to avoid the lock or trigger the discharge.
They generally use borescopes (tiny cameras) to look within the hole and observe what's going on with the mechanism. Once the safe is open, a good pro may usually repair the particular small hole so well that you'd never even this was drilled. The secure stays functional, and your stuff remains intact.

Keeping it from taking place again
Once the פורץ כספות has effectively gotten you back into your safe, they'll probably give you some advice on how to avoid a do it again performance.
- Change the particular batteries every year: Don't wait for the low-battery warning. Just do it on the birthday celebration or New Year's Day. Use high-quality brand-name batteries, not really the cheap ones from the junk drawer.
- Service the locking mechanism: Mechanised dials need the little TLC every few years. A fast cleaning and reduction in friction by an expert can prevent the parts from requisitioning up.
- Don't overstuff this: Leave just a little breathing room close to the door. In the event that you have to push the door shut along with your shoulder, you're requesting a lockout.
- Keep your code somewhere safe (but not in the particular safe! ): It noises obvious, but you'd be surprised just how many people fasten the only copy of the backup crucial or code within the safe by itself.
